SAFE ARRIVAL & EXIT Children under the age of 16yrs should not be left unattended, we cannot be responsible for any children outside of the classroom. Parents are asked to be there should we need them at any time.
Parents are asked to inform a teacher or another class parent waiting if an older school child is to be left alone.
Please make sure your child has a contact number to reach you - we suggest keeping it clearly written somewhere in/on their dance bag.
Parents are responsible for their children before and after class. We ask that main doors to the venue are kept closed.
Parents asked to always accompany their child into the hall, just in case it is closed and classes cancelled for any reason Please see below *

UNIFORM
Comfortable dance wear is worn to all classes.
SHOES
Appropriate shoes to be worn in class.
We prefer that the children do not dance bare foot- there could always be 'little bits' on the floor, accidently dropped or brought in on people's shoes whilst coming and going.
Please take extra care as ballet and tap shoes can be slippery. New children without dance shoes may wear a comfortable non slip shoe. Children without tap shoes may wear a hard sole shoe.
The premises is always prepared/cleaned before classes start with spaces cleared and floors checked.
HAIR
When training, a dancer always wears their hair off the face in a bun or similar style. Preferably with no fringe.
DanceCraft Dancers wear team/class colour hair bow bows, bands or scrunchies - they look gorgeous!

*Class changes or cancellations.
If in the unlikely event, we are unable to take classes we will inform you via WhatsApp/text message/email or a notice will be put up at the hall.
Any classes cancelled that cannot be covered, will either be re-arranged, carried over to the next term, an alternative class offered either in person, online or refunded in full.
Classes cancelled due to circumstances beyond our control are not refunded, for example, severe weather conditions, gales, snow & ice - Government Lockdown, e.g. rules due to Covid-19.
*Occasionally classes may need to be restructured. This will be carried out with prior notice and the minimum of disruption.
